Goldman Posts Record $1 Trillion Announced M&A in 2026, Signals Higher Advisory Revenue

A record pace of announced M&A signals higher potential advisory fees and backlog for GS, supporting near-term revenue visibility; however, actual gains depend on deal closings and mix, creating upside risk if closings accelerate.

Goldman Sachs reports more than $1 trillion in announced M&A in 2026 to date, a half-year record per Dealogic data cited on LinkedIn. The milestone signals stronger advisory revenue potential in the near term, but earnings depend on deal closings and the quality of the pipeline.

  • GS cites over $1 trillion in announced 2026 M&A—half-year record.
  • Record pace implies higher advisory fees if deals close.
  • Market impact hinges on closings; M&A cycle remains cyclical.
  • GS likely retains leadership in advisory amid robust deal activity.
